The transcript discusses the challenges faced by the Chinese financial market, particularly in Shanghai, highlighting the credibility issues and market volatility. It examines the implications for the global economy, the government's response, and the distinction between market fluctuations and economic fundamentals. The discussion also touches on the complexity of managing a larger financial system and the ongoing efforts to stabilize the market.
